If you're on TD's, you will do better than 2:00. The grip is incredible. The way they can go through corners is phenomenal. However, be aware that they seem to be the fastest right when they're brand new. Three of us have had the same experience------you have fresh TD's on the car; you go out and the first couple hot laps net some incredible times; then the rest of the day you're chasing those times and never seem to get back there. So, hopefully, you'll have some open track on your first hot laps with those tires.
Also, watch the outside driver's front tire. For me, it wore faster than the edges of the rest of the tires, and I have over -3 degrees of front camber. Off-Ramp, the entry to Cotton Corners, Riverside and Sweeper are some of the most abusive turns at BW 13CW, and they all turn to the right, so the driver-side front outer edge gets hammered. After a couple sessions, I suggest switching the front tires (which means running them backwards) to share the abuse on the driver's front outside edge.
As far as size, I went 265/35/18, 295/30/18 (APEX ARC-8). Works awesome with the blower.
